ENGR10 — Surveying

Units: 3.5 Hours: 36 hours LEC; 81 hours LAB Grade Options: Letter Grade Term Typically Every fall term This course applies theory and principles of plane surveying: office computations and design; operation of surveying field equipment; and production of engineering plans/maps. Topics include distances, angles, and directions; differential leveling; traversing; property/boundary surveys; topographic surveys/mappings; volume/earthwork; horizontal and vertical curves; land description techniques; and GPS. Extensive fieldwork using tapes, levels, transits, theodolites, total stations, and GPS will occur. (CSU, C-ID ENGR 180)

Prerequisites: MATH38B, MATH39, ENGR180
